Weddings, decorating ideas and great shoes might be some of the things that spring to mind when Pinterest is mentioned, but the police department of Pottstown, Pennsylvania has a totally different take on the popular social media site: Catching wanted criminals.

According to Brandie Kessler of The Pottstown Mercury:

When Mandy Jenkins stopped by The Mercury a few months ago and told us a bit about various new social media, myself and reporter Evan Brandt thought Pinterest, because of its photo-focus, would be perfect for a wanted by police list.

[...] I decided to create a list on Pinterest. It’s great because it’s easy to update, easy to view on a smartphone and you don’t even need a Pinterest account to view it. Plus, it’s simple to post the link on Facebook and Twitter, and our readers love it.

Not only has reader interest peaked, but so have apprehensions by a whopping fifty-eight percent.
